Abstract
A thin pivotal apparatus includes a holding seat, an arc-shaped driven member and at least one torsional force generation member. The holding seat includes a base, a housing space and a first assembly portion and a second assembly portion that are located on the base corresponding to two opposite sides of the housing space. The arc-shaped driven member is located in the housing space and includes an operational portion, a curved portion connected to the operational portion and a driving portion extended from the curved portion toward the operational portion to couple with the first assembly portion to form a pivotal relationship. Each torsional force generation member includes a first connection portion located on the second assembly portion, a second connection portion connected to the junction of the driving portion and the curved portion, and a hydraulic portion connected to the first connection portion and the second connection portion.

(10) The arc-shaped driven member 12 is located in the housing space 112 and includes an operational portion 121, a curved portion 122 connected to the operational portion 121 and a driving portion 123 extended from the curved portion 122 toward the operational portion 121 and coupled with the first assembly portion 113 to form a pivotal relationship therewith. In addition, the arc-shaped driven member 12 can be coupled on the upper case 21 and be driven thereof. The operational portion 121, the curved portion 122 and the driving portion 123 can be formed in an integrated manner. In practice, the operational portion 121 can be a linear tablet to facilitate assembly with the electronic device 2. The profile of the curved portion 122 can be changed according to actual requirement. The driving portion 123 can be extended toward the operational portion 121 and remote from the curved portion 122 to form a deformation angle 125 against a horizontal extension line 124 of the operational portion 121 as shown in
(11) Each torsional force generation member 13 includes a first connection portion 131 installed on the second assembly portion 114, a second connection portion 132 connected to the junction of the driving portion 123 and the curved portion 122, and a hydraulic portion 133 to bridge the first connection portion 131 and the second connection portion 132 and driven by the driving portion to form synchronous movement to generate a corresponding swivel torsional force. More specifically, each torsional force generation member 13 can be implemented through hydraulic fashion, namely, each hydraulic portion 133 is formed in a hydraulic structure. More specifically, each hydraulic portion 133 includes an oil cylinder 134 and a push-pull rod 135 located in the oil cylinder 134 to move on a linear displacement against the oil cylinder 134 so that the oil cylinder 134 generates a corresponding swivel torsional force according to alteration of the linear displacement. Moreover, in order to enhance the assembly strength of each torsional force generation member 13 on other structural elements, in yet another embodiment the holding seat 11 includes a second axle 117 located on the second assembly portion 114 to form a pivotal relationship with the first connection portion 131 of each torsional force generation member 13. In addition, the arc-shaped driven member 12 includes a pivotal portion 126 located at the junction of the driving portion 123 and the curved portion 122 to couple with the second connection portion 132. Moreover, during implementation of the thin pivotal apparatus 1 the number of the torsional force generation member 13 can be configured and deployed according to actual requirements. In one embodiment the thin pivotal apparatus 1 includes two torsional force generation members 13 and 14 that can be positioned at one side of the arc-shaped driven member 12.

(14) As a conclusion, the thin pivotal apparatus of the invention includes a holding seat, an arc-shaped driven member and at least one torsional force generation member. The holding seat includes a base, a housing space formed on the base and a first assembly portion and a second assembly portion located on the base and corresponding to two opposite ends of the housing space. The arc-shaped driven member is located in the housing space and includes an operational portion, a curved portion connected to the operational portion and a driving portion extended from the curved portion toward the operational portion and coupled with the first assembly portion to form a pivotal relationship. Each torsional force generation member includes a first connection portion coupled on the second assembly portion, a second connection portion connected to the junction of the driving portion and the curved portion and a hydraulic portion connected to the first connection portion and the second connection portion and driven by the driving portion to move synchronously to generate a corresponding swivel torsional force. Thus, total structure of the pivotal apparatus can be made thinner, and the torsional force generation member can provide a corresponding swivel torsional force according to the swivel extent of the arc-shaped driven member to meet user's requirements.
